What Does ADU Engineering Include for Your Beaverton Project?

ADU engineering encompasses the comprehensive structural design and analysis required for your accessory dwelling unit. This includes calculations for foundation systems, framing, roof loads, and lateral force resistance, all tailored to your specific ADU type—whether it's a detached structure, a garage conversion, or an attached addition. We produce detailed structural drawings and specifications that are essential for obtaining building permits and guiding the construction process.

Our approach begins with a thorough review of the architectural plans, site survey, and geotechnical report. We then use advanced structural analysis software to model the ADU's behavior under various loads, including gravity, wind, and seismic forces. This allows us to optimize material usage while strictly adhering to the Oregon Structural Specialty Code (OSSC) and local Beaverton amendments, ensuring a robust and cost-effective design.

For Beaverton properties, specific engineering considerations are paramount. The region experiences moderate seismic activity, which means our designs incorporate appropriate shear wall and diaphragm detailing to resist earthquake forces. Additionally, the prevalence of expansive clay soils in some areas of Beaverton necessitates careful foundation design, often involving deep foundations like piers or specialized slab-on-grade systems to prevent differential settlement and structural distress.

Why is Expert ADU Engineering Critical for Beaverton Homeowners?

Expert ADU engineering is critical for Beaverton homeowners because it directly impacts the safety, longevity, and legality of your accessory dwelling unit. Without a sound structural design, your ADU could be vulnerable to the region's specific environmental challenges, such as seismic events or the unique soil conditions found across the Tualatin Valley basin.

Beaverton's climate, with its wet winters and occasional heavy snow loads, demands structures engineered to withstand these forces. Proper engineering accounts for these environmental stressors, designing roof systems and framing that can safely bear accumulated snow and manage rainwater runoff effectively. This prevents future issues like roof collapse, water intrusion, or premature material degradation.

Furthermore, accurate engineering ensures your ADU complies with all local building codes and permitting requirements set by the City of Beaverton and Washington County. This avoids costly delays during the permitting process, prevents rework during construction, and protects you from potential legal liabilities down the road. Frequently Asked Questions

The ADU engineering design process in Beaverton typically takes 3 to 6 weeks from the start of design to the delivery of final structural drawings. This timeline can vary depending on the complexity of the ADU, the completeness of the architectural plans provided, and the responsiveness of all parties involved. Factors like unique foundation requirements due to specific soil conditions or intricate framing designs can extend this period slightly. We work efficiently to meet your project schedule while maintaining design integrity.
Yes, for most new detached or attached ADUs in Beaverton, a separate geotechnical report is often required by the City of Beaverton building department. This report assesses the soil conditions on your specific property, providing critical data for foundation design. The information from the geotechnical engineer informs our structural engineer on appropriate foundation types, bearing capacities, and potential settlement issues, which means your ADU's foundation will be designed correctly for your site.
The cost for ADU engineering services in Beaverton typically ranges from $3,000 to $8,000, but this can vary significantly based on the ADU's size, complexity, and specific site challenges. A simple detached ADU on a flat lot with good soil will be on the lower end, while a multi-story ADU, a garage conversion with significant structural modifications, or a site with challenging soil conditions will incur higher engineering fees.
